What is a remote vehicle test driver?

Remote vehicle test drivers are professionals who operate and evaluate vehicles—often autonomous or semi-autonomous—remotely using advanced control systems and software. Their main role is to ensure the performance, safety, and reliability of these vehicles by conducting tests in real-world or simulated environments. They provide valuable feedback to engineers and developers, helping improve vehicle technologies before they reach consumers. This job typically requires a strong understanding of vehicle mechanics, remote control technologies, and safety protocols. Remote vehicle test drivers may work for automotive manufacturers, technology companies, or research institutions.

What does a remote vehicle test driver do?

As a Remote Vehicle Test Driver, your workday primarily involves operating vehicles (often prototypes or those with advanced driver-assistance systems) along pre-defined routes while monitoring vehicle performance and safety. Although much of your time is spent driving, collaboration is frequent—you’ll regularly communicate findings and feedback to engineers, software developers, and data analysts. You may also participate in debrief meetings or log detailed reports on anomalies and system behaviors. This role requires strong attention to detail and effective communication skills to ensure accurate feedback and safe testing processes.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ote vehicle test driver?

To thrive as a Remote Vehicle Test Driver, you need a valid driver's license, a clean driving record, and a strong understanding of automotive systems and safety protocols. Familiarity with vehicle diagnostic tools, telematics software, and remote control systems is typically required. Attention to detail, strong communication, and the ability to follow complex instructions are valuable soft skills in this role. These skills ensure accurate data collection, safe vehicle operation, and effective collaboration with engineering teams to improve vehicle performance.
